Disruption ongoing between Leeds and Harrogate

Train services between Leeds and Harrogate continue to face disruption following a weather-related incident earlier today (Thursday).

There will be no further service on the route this evening and services will be reduced to one per hour in each direction tomorrow morning (Friday).

Colleagues from Network Rail remain at the scene and are working hard to fully open the line as quickly as possible. 

Northern customers are advised to allow extra time for journeys between Leeds and Harrogate to and to check carefully before travelling.

A Northern spokesperson said: "It's been an extremely difficult day, particularly for our customers in Yorkshire. Sadly, as a result of today's issues, we are facing more disruption on Friday, though customers can be assured that the rail industry is doing all it can to restore full services as soon as possible.

“Again, we'd like to thank our customers for their patience and ask that anyone who is planning to travel on this route on Friday allows extra time for journeys and checks ahead before setting off as delays and cancellations are possible.”

For up-to-date travel information check the Northern website or National Rail Enquiries.

Delay Repay compensation is available for any customers whose journeys are delayed by 15 minutes or longer this afternoon.
